Smart Shades
When you construct a private theater, it’s important to tackle even the small details, like ensuring light doesn’t stream in from outside sources. Flashes of light coming in from windows and doors can really affect your entertainment experience and create an uncomfortable glare. In these situations, the Audio Images team works around your home’s unique layout to address these issues. Installing blackout smart shades is a great solution. And when you integrate them into your smart home control system, you can call the projector down from the ceiling, turn off the lights, and lower the shades by pressing one button for a stunning home theater experience.
Custom Seating
The seats you place in your private theater also significantly impact the quality of your experience. Ultimately, you should choose custom seating that is comfortable, but you also want to keep your guests in mind too. Who will be using the theater? A home theater sofa or sectional will give your group the ability to snuggle and get close. Alternatively, you could go more traditional and get stadium-style seats that give every individual more personal space. We have many options for you to choose from, including leather, microfiber, or fabric. Automated Lighting
Lights, camera, action! It’s time for the show. Setting the stage for a fun evening of movies starts with the lighting. You can’t watch "Fast and the Furious 8" while bright lights are blaring down on you. An integrated smart home control system allows you to dim the lights and turn on the movie simultaneously. Use an app on a tablet or a handy universal remote to manage the volume and lighting settings. If anyone needs to get up for more popcorn or a bathroom break, you can turn specific lights on to illuminate their pathway without disrupting the rest of the audience.
